Abstract
The invention discloses an unattended substation main transformer operation monitoring system with a photographing function. The system comprises a main transformer array, a camera array arranged corresponding to the main transformer array, a server with a camera distribution map database and a monitoring center. The camera array is used for photographing corresponding main transformers and transmits the photographing data to the server. The server transmits the photographing data to the monitoring center. Moreover, the main transformer array is in communication connection with the server through the wireless communication module. The monitoring center can start the cameras corresponding to the main transformers needing to be observed for observation according to the camera distribution map database. According to the system, when the working states of the main transformers are abnormal, the monitoring center can call the data recorded by the cameras corresponding to the main transformers through the camera distribution map database and carry out remote diagnosis on the main transformers.
